> NIFI-5195 provided clustering in Docker containers and provided a sample 
> config file.  This currently is done via each node being defined as an 
> independent service.  Extending the container to allow for some specification 
> of properties in an automated manner could allow a cluster to be established 
> with a single node service definition and then more fully utilize the 
> docker-compose commands
